Top Italian Perfume Brands
Acqua di Parma: Timeless Elegance
Established in 1916, Acqua di Parma is among Italy’s most famous perfume houses. Colonia, their trademark fragrance, is a sophisticated, fresh mix of citrus and floral elements. Men and women are equally like the brand, precisely the same.
Gucci: Modern and Strong
Combining modern with elegance, Gucci perfumes offer distinctive smells for every personality type. Perfect depictions of their creativity and smells like Gucci Bloom and Guilty appeal to those who appreciate intense or floral aromas.
Dolce & Gabbana: Mediterranean Spirit
Dolce & Gabbana smells mirror the essence of the Mediterranean way of life. Light Blue, one of their top sellers, catches the spirit of an Italian summer by the sea by mixing zesty citrus with floral undertones.
Best Italian Perfumes for Women
Versace Bright Crystal
Women who enjoy flowery and fruit scents often choose Bright Crystal by Versace. It is magnolia, peony, and pomegranate elements produce a light but elegant perfume for daily use.
Bvlgari Omnia Crystalline
The transparency of crystals inspires Bvlgari Omnia Crystalline. This perfume combines musk, bamboo, and lotus flower undertones, ideal for those seeking understated, subtle scents.
Acqua di Parma Peonia Nobile
Premium floral fragrance Peonics Nobile blends peony, rose, and musk. This is a traditional selection for women seeking a sophisticated and feminine scent for a significant occasion.
Best Italian Perfumes for Men
Acqua di Parma Colonia Essenza
Colonia Essenza is a refined variation of the original Colonia. Men who like traditional elegance will find this smell ideal, with citrus top notes, woodsy undertones, and a hint of musk.
Prada Luna Rossa
Competitive sailing drives Prada Luna Rossa. Its fresh and athletic lavender, bitter orange, and ambroxan scent are ideal for energetic and daring guys.
Valentino Uomo
Warm and refined, Valentino Uomo smells like leather, coffee, and cedarwood. Men seeking powerful, manly fragrances with a trace of Italian refinement will find great value here.

Tips for Maintaining Your Perfume
Store in a Cool, Dark Place
Your smell may suffer from heat, light, and humidity. Store your fragrances cool and dark if you want their scent and lifetime to last.
Apply to Pulse Points
For the most significant effect, dab perfume behind the ears, wrists, and neck. These hotspots intensify the fragrance.

How to Layer Italian Perfumes for a Unique Scent
The Art of Perfume Layering
Layering is mixing several scents to get a customized, distinctive aroma. Versatile Italian fragrances may be combined with other scents to accentuate particular elements and highlight your scent character.
Pairing Complementary Notes
If you want to stack fragrances successfully, select fragrances with complementing notes. For freshness, a floral aroma may be combined with a citrus scent; a woodsy background note will accentuate a light, airy perfume.
